1 Introduction

This manual describes the installation and the basic operation of the OTM_ motorized change-over
switch. The instructive part is followed by a section on available accessories.

1.1 Use of symbols

Hazardous voltage: warns about a situation where a hazardous voltage may cause physical injury to a
person or damage to equipment.

General warning: warns about a situation where something other than electrical equipment may
cause physical injury to a person or damage to equipment.

Caution: provides important information or warns about a situation that may have a detrimental effect
on equipment.

Information: provides important information about the equipment.

3 Quick start

This is a quick guide meant for you who only need a reminder of how to operate the unit. For more
detailed instructions, see chapter 6

3.1 Controlling the switch electrically (remote control)


To control the switch electrically:
1. Remove the handle from the switch panel.
You can remove the handle in any position.
2. Turn the Motor/Manual selector to the Motor (M) position to enable electrical control.

M
M

Man.
Man.
A00308A

Fig. 3-1 Controlling the switch electrically

To disable electrical control, lock the locking latch with a padlock.

After the locking latch has been locked, the switch cannot be controlled electrically.

You can lock electrical control in any position (I, 0, II).

5 Connecting the control circuit

5 Connecting the control circuit

The electrical installation and maintenance of OTM_motorized change-over switches may be


performed only by an authorized electrician. Do not attempt any installation or maintenance actions
when an OTM_motorized change-over switch is connected to the electrical mains. Before starting the
work, make sure that the switch is de-energized.

Do not couple power for the control terminal. See the correct terminal for the power supply in Figure
5-1.

The control voltage (output C = 24Vdc) on the control terminal is non-isolated, see box 2 in Figure
5-1.

The maximum cable length to ensure faultless operation of the push-buttons, see table 7-1

When relay outputs are used with inductive loads (such as relays, contactors and motors), they must
be protected from voltage spikes using varistors, RC-protectors (AC current) or DC current diodes
(DC current).

6 Operating the OTM_motorized change-over switch

6 Operating the OTM_motorized change-


over switch

Never open any covers on the product. There may be dangerous external control voltages inside the
OTM_ motorized change-over switch even if the voltage is turned off.

Never handle control cables when the voltage of the OTM_ motorized change-over switch or external
control circuits is connected.

Exercise sufficient caution when handling the unit.

6.1 Electrical control


You can control the switch electrically by using the push-buttons or a similar control concept.

To control the switch electrically:


1. Release the handle from the switch panel by pressing down the locking latch under the switch panel
and pulling the handle off, see Figure 6-1.

3. Control the OTM_ motorized change-over switch with the push-buttons via impulse control or
continuous control.

The switch can be operated from position I to position II (or from II to I) without stopping it in position
0. For example, if switch I is closed and you press the push-button (II), the control unit first runs switch
I in the open position and then the control unit runs switch II from the open to the closed position.

18
1SCC303002M9701
Installation and operating instruction
6 Operating the OTM_motorized change-over switch

The motor operator is protected from overloading by a fuse (F1) under the motor operator, see Figure
2-1. Only use the same type of fuse that is described on the label close to the fuse.

6.1.1 Impulse control


When using impulse control, the switch is controlled by electric impulses. When you press the control
button, the switch is driven to the corresponding position (I, 0 or II). The control impulse must last more
than 100ms to take effect. A new command cannot be given until the switch has reached the position of
the previous command. Figure 6-3 shows the operation of the switch with impulse control.

If a new command is given before the switch has reached the position of the previous command, the
fuse (F1) may operate.

6.1.2 Continuous control


When using continuous control, the control command is supplied to the switch continuously. When you
press the control button, the switch is driven to the corresponding position (I, 0 or II). Control of
position 0 will over-run control of the other positions; that is, if you simultaneously give the 0 command
and another command, the switch is driven to position 0. Figure 6-4 shows the operation of the switch
with continuous control.

19
1SCC303002M9701
The continuous control command can be given with push buttons, cam switches or with relays
incorporated in PLC equipment or with other suitable contacts.

6.3 Lockings
You can lock the OTM_motorized change-over switch to a specific position.

6.3.1 Locking electrical control


You can lock the electrical control to any position (I, 0, II).

To lock electrical control:


1. Pull up the locking latch under the switch panel.
2. Place the padlock under the latch, see Figure 6-7.

6.3.2 Locking manual operation


By default, manual operation can only be locked to position 0. Locking to positions I and II is optional
and possible only with modifications to the switch panel.

To lock manual operation:


1. Turn the handle to the required position.
2. Pull out the clip from the handle and place the padlock on the handle, see Figure 6-8.

7 Technical data

7.1 Motor operator


Table 7-1 General technical data of motor operators
Motor operator Value
Rated operational voltage Ue 220 - 240 VAC
Operating voltage range 0,85... 1,1 x Ue
Operating angle 90° 0-I, I-0, 0-II, II-0; 180° I-0-II
Operating time See Table 7-2
Protection degree IP 20

Voltage supply PE N L
Cable of the push-buttons (no SELV) C II I 0
Cross section; solid/stranded 1.,5… 2,5 mm2
Maximum cable length 100 m
State information of locking (no SELV)
Handle attached or motor operator locked 11-12-14 (C/O)
Locking motor operator 23-24 (NO)
Rated impulse withstand voltage Uimp
Between terminals 4 kV
Between state information contacts 4 kV

Operating temperature -5... +40 °C


Transportation and storage temperature -40... +70 °C
Altitude Max. 2000m
